Economic, political, historical, and geographic profiles of 250+ countries and global regions. Includes contact information for officials and features information on over 1,700 international organizations.
Europa World Plus is the online version of the Europa World Year Book and the nine-volume Regional Surveys of the World series:
Africa South of the Sahara
Central and South-Eastern Europe
Eastern Europe
Russia and Central Asia
The Far East and Australasia
The Middle East and North Africa
South America
Central America and the Caribbean
South Asia
The USA and Canada
Western Europe.
The Europa World Year Book was first published in 1926 and it covers political and economic information from more than 250 countries and territories. Europa World Plus includes a section that profiles various International Organizations, and there is a section that provides Comparative Statistics on countries along with accompanying data that can be exported as CSV and tab-delimited data.
This database only includes the most recent information.

Presents comprehensive information and documents on modern genocide, focusing on the beginning of the 20th century to the present day.
Includes more than 300 primary sources such as memoirs, narratives, and domestic and international legal documents that illustrate the progression and outcome of genocide, as well as first-hand accounts that depict its impact on entire societies as well as on the lives of individuals.
